Charlotte, NC (SportsNetwork.com) – Al Jefferson poured in a game-high 35 points and pulled down eight rebounds to lead the Charlotte Bobcats to a 108-98 win over the New York Knicks on Tuesday. Kemba Walker added 25 points, seven rebounds and five assists and Gerald Henderson scored 17 for the Bobcats, who had dropped three straight entering the contest. Carmelo Anthony scored a team-high 20 points, Amare Stoudemire added 17 points and Raymond Felton scored 13 for the Knicks, who had a five-game winning streak snapped.
Final Score: Indiana 116, Sacramento 92
Indianapolis, IN (SportsNetwork.com) – Paul George scored 31 points to lead the Indiana Pacers to a 116-92 drubbing of the Sacramento Kings from Bankers Life Fieldhouse. David West finished with 16 points and eight rebounds, while Lance Stephenson scored 13 points to go along with five rebounds and five assists in the win. Roy Hibbert and C.J. Watson each added 10 points for Indiana, which has won five of six overall and seven of the last 10 meetings over Sacramento. DeMarcus Cousins recorded his 11th straight double-double with 31 points and 13 rebounds for the Kings, who had their three-game winning streak snapped. Rudy Gay added 12 points in the loss.
Final Score: Memphis 90, Oklahoma City 87
Memphis, TN (SportsNetwork.com) – Courtney Lee scored a season-high 24 points and Zach Randolph recorded a double-double of 23 points and 13 rebounds to lead the Memphis Grizzlies to a 90-87 win over the Oklahoma City Thunder from FedEx Forum. Mike Conley finished with 19 points and seven assists for Memphis, which has won three straight games. Marc Gasol returned to the Grizzlies’ lineup after a 23-game absence because of an MCL sprain and finished with 12 points and four rebounds in the win. Kevin Durant poured in 37 points for Oklahoma City, which has lost three straight on the road. Reggie Jackson added 17 points and Serge Ibaka scored 11 points with nine rebounds and four blocks in the setback.
Final Score: Cleveland 120, LA Lakers 118
Los Angeles, CA (SportsNetwork.com) – Luol Deng poured in 27 points as the Cleveland Cavaliers held off the Los Angeles Lakers for a 120-118 win on Tuesday. Deng was 5-for-5 from 3-point range for Cleveland, which finished 13-of-17 from distance overall. Anderson Varejao added 18 points and 18 rebounds, Tristan Thompson had 15 points and 13 boards and Dion Waiters chipped in with 17 points off the bench for the Cavaliers, winners in three of their last four. Nick Young poured in a game-high 28 points, Jodie Meeks scored 26 and Pau Gasol finished with 20 points and 12 boards for the Lakers, losers in five straight.
